Output 64e851e7e21db8c3c03cc77893e938a51cd44e6153b9f73184431684571496d6:0

value
279725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f4bc6efd4a3674bd8ac3ba3c3736e21c3a31fab OP_EQUAL
address
38vJ5nPUs5SJEZtxp4ave4UKKr7QCvyWn8
transaction
64e851e7e21db8c3c03cc77893e938a51cd44e6153b9f73184431684571496d6
spent
true